Worthen Meadows Reservoir is a 92-acre cold, clear oligotrophic lake in Fremont County, Wyoming. Water quality is graded B based on 1 sampling years through 2021. Limited fish-species data available. Public access is available with 1 public boat landing. Compared to the 17 other monitored lakes in Fremont County, Worthen Meadows Reservoir ranks #10 for water quality.
Source: EPA Water Quality Portal sampling records, Wyoming DEQ, last sampled 2021-09-08. Grade methodology: LakeQuality methodology.

Reservoir Info (USACE NID)
Worthen Meadows Reservoir is a man-made reservoir impounded by the Enlargement of Worthen Meadows (completed 1958), built primarily for water supply on the Roaring Fork Creek; earth-type dam, 46 ft tall and 850 ft long.
- Surface area
- 92 ac
- Normal storage
- 1,504 ac-ft
- Max storage
- 2,516 ac-ft
- Drainage area
- 12.7 sq mi
- Hazard class
- High
- Owner
- CITY OF LANDER
All listed purposes: Water Supply;Irrigation.
Source: USACE National Inventory of Dams, NID ID WY01058 · Operator website · Matched by proximity (0.13 km)
